Experienced Java Software Engineer with a demonstrated history of working in the information technology and services industry. Skilled in Java, Spring, Rest APIs, SQL Databases, JPA, JUnit, Git, Kafka, Google Cloud Platform.
-
Senior Software EngineerBlockcorp Jun 2023 - PresentLuxembourg, LuxembourgGluCare is at the forefront of remote patient monitoring and digital therapeutics, specializing in innovative approaches to optimize diabetes care. The company integrates continuous blood monitoring with real-time tracking of dietary habits, physical activity, sleep, and other health metrics, aiming to make diabetes management more accessible and efficient. With user consent, the app accesses Apple HealthKit or CareKit to gather comprehensive health data, including Blood Pressure, Heart Rate, Glucose levels, Steps, Physical Exercise, Weight, Food log, Hydration, Smoking habits, Sleep patterns, and Alcohol intake. This data can be input manually or synced from connected devices and applications.Role:As a Senior Software Engineer at Blockcorp, I have been actively involved in maintaining and enhancing an existing Django application, ensuring its continued functionality and implementing new features. In addition to this, I have been developing Spring Boot microservices, including one that integrates third-party gadget devices like the Oura Ring and Fitbit smartwatch to track health records. Another key project has been the development of a microservice dedicated to managing surveys, further contributing to the comprehensive health monitoring ecosystem we are building.Incresead performanc of Django application services using correct index of postresql database.Resolved many reactive programming issues on spring boot microservices because of good design. -
Senior Java Software EngineerIag, Image Analysis Group Dec 2020 - May 2023Tehran, IranWe worked indirectly for IAG, Image Analysis Group, Ltd.(UK) which is a platform to accelerate novel drug development by using the right analytical tools and modern trial infrastructure. At IAG, they are committed to helping biotech and pharma partners by accelerating their R&D pipelines through advanced analytics, IAG’s technology solutions and imaging contract research services.Analyzed, designed, implemented, deployed web application back end components using spring boot microservices and GCP.Added unit tests using junit, mockito, and integration tests using test containers (postgre,kafka), mock mvc to produce events and automate tests of rest apis.Helped the team to provide standard rest apis using best practices and common design patterns and also refactor existing apis.Helped the team to provide microservices with better performance by optimizing connection pools and queries, tuning scaling.Worked collaboratively in a team with fellow developers, sharing ideas to solve complex and challenging business. -
Senior Java Software EngineerSadad Informatics Corporation Jul 2018 - Nov 2020Tehran Province, IranSADAD Informatics Corporation is the executive arm of Iran’s largest banking institution, Bank Melli Iran, in providing electronic services to various segments of society. BAAM is the most famous product in Sadad to provide web and mobile applications with many features.Analyzed, designed, implemented, deployed different rest services in microservices using Java EE and Spring boot.Also, integrated external rest and soap services as our providers.Debugged serious problems in the projects to find existing problems in different scenarios.Migration from one monolithic architecture to microservices architecture. Designed a good solution on how to extract different microservices correctly.Maintained and improved performance of existing services.Demonstrated OO design skills and familiarity with GOF design patternsHelped team to provide CI/CD. -
Software DeveloperTecnotree Corporation Sep 2017 - Jun 2018 -
Java DeveloperViratech Sharif Jan 2017 - Aug 2017Tehran
Mohammad Pourabedini Skills
Mohammad Pourabedini Education Details
-
Computer Software Engineering -
Semnan UniversityComputer Science
Frequently Asked Questions about Mohammad Pourabedini
What company does Mohammad Pourabedini work for?
Mohammad Pourabedini works for Blockcorp
What is Mohammad Pourabedini's role at the current company?
Mohammad Pourabedini's current role is Senior Software Engineer.
What schools did Mohammad Pourabedini attend?
Mohammad Pourabedini attended Sharif University Of Technology, Semnan University.
What skills is Mohammad Pourabedini known for?
Mohammad Pourabedini has skills like Java, Spring Framework, Java Enterprise Edition, Maven, Jpa, Sql, Git, Junit.
Not the Mohammad Pourabedini you were looking for?
-
mohammad pourabedini
Tehran
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ial